What are Fiberglass Doors?

Fiberglass doors are a popular choice for homeowners, builders, and architects due to their durability and energy efficiency. They offer superior insulation compared to other door materials such as wood or steel, making them an ideal option for homes in colder climates. Fiberglass doors also require less maintenance than other types of doors since they don’t warp or rot over time.

Fiberglass doors come in a variety of styles and designs that can be customized to fit any home’s aesthetic. They are available in smooth finishes with no visible grain lines or textured surfaces that mimic the look of real woodgrain without the upkeep associated with wooden doors. Additionally, fiberglass can be stained or painted, so you can create one that matches your existing décor perfectly.

In terms of security, fiberglass is extremely strong and resistant to break-ins when properly installed by a professional contractor. It also has soundproofing properties which make it great for keeping out noise from outside sources like traffic or construction sites nearby.

Overall, fiberglass offers many advantages over traditional door materials including increased energy efficiency, low maintenance requirements, customizable design options and enhanced security features; making it an excellent choice for anyone looking to upgrade any exterior doors.

Advantages of Fiberglass Doors

Fiberglass doors are becoming increasingly popular due to their many advantages over other materials. They are energy efficient, durable, and require little maintenance.

Energy Efficiency:

Fiberglass is an excellent insulator and helps keep the heat in during winter months and out during summer months. This can help reduce energy costs by up to 25%. The foam core insulation also reduces noise transfer from outside sources.

Durability:

Fiberglass doors are highly resistant to cracking, warping, splitting or denting that may occur with wood or steel doors over time. In addition, they will not rot like wooden doors do when exposed to moisture for extended periods of time.

Low Maintenance Requirements:

Unlike wood or steel doors which need regular painting or staining, fiberglass requires no additional treatment once installed. It also resists fading from UV rays so it will look great for years without any extra effort on your part.

Tips for New Pre-hung Fiberglass Doors & Frames.

Installing an exterior prehung fiberglass door may seem like a daunting task, but with the right tools and instructions, it can be done easily. Follow the steps below to install your exterior prehung fiberglass door:

Tools and materials needed:

Step 1: Measure and prepare the opening

Measure the width and height of the opening to ensure that your exterior fiberglass door will fit properly. If the opening is too large, you will need to fill in the gap with additional framing. If it is too small, you will need to remove some framing to make it larger.

Step 2: Position the door

Position the prehung door in the opening and use shims to hold it in place. Ensure that the door is level, plumb, and square. Check the door jamb for any bows or twists, and adjust the shims as necessary to make the door fit snugly.

Step 3: Secure the door

Once the door is properly positioned, secure it in place by drilling pilot holes through the door jamb and into the framing of the house. Insert screws through the pilot holes to attach the door to the framing. Be sure to use exterior-grade screws that are long enough to go through the jamb and into the framing.

Step 4: Check for gaps

Check for any gaps between the door and the framing. Use shims to fill any gaps and ensure that the door is properly aligned.

Step 5: Install weatherstripping

Install weatherstripping around the edges of the door to prevent air leaks and improve energy efficiency.

Step 6: Apply caulking

Apply exterior caulking around the outside of the door to seal any gaps and prevent water from entering the house.

Step 7: Install the hardware

Maintenance Tips for Fiberglass Doors

However, like any other door material, they require regular maintenance in order to keep them looking new and functioning properly over time. Here are some tips for maintaining your fiberglass door:

1. Clean Regularly:

Fiberglass doors should be cleaned regularly with a mild detergent or soap solution and a soft cloth or sponge. Avoid using abrasive cleaners as these can damage the finish of the door.

2. Inspect Door Seals:

Check the weatherstripping around your fiberglass door periodically for signs of wear or damage such as cracking, splitting, tearing, etc., which can lead to air leaks and drafts if not addressed promptly. Replace any worn out seals immediately with ones specifically designed for use on fiberglass doors in order to ensure an effective seal against air infiltration.

3. Lubricate Moving Parts:

Make sure that all moving parts such as hinges and locks are lubricated regularly with silicone-based lubricants in order to prevent sticking or binding when opening/closing the door or operating its hardware components (e.g., handles).

4. Paint Touch-Ups:

If you notice any scratches on your fiberglass door’s surface, you may want to consider doing touch-ups by applying paint that matches its original color exactly (or very closely). This will help maintain its aesthetic appeal while also protecting it from further damage caused by exposure to moisture and other elements over time (eg., UV rays).
